Suzanne Dalla Santa
CHAIRPERSONSue joined the Business Port Augusta Board in 2023 to help identify initiatives that support small businesses through information sharing, training, networking, and advocating for greater transparency in a changing economic landscape.
Professional Journey
With over 50 years of experience, Sue has worked in her family’s plumbing business and held leadership roles in both local and state government. Her strengths lie in management, project coordination, and launching new initiatives, always guided by consultation and community input to achieve positive outcomes.
Tracey Brimble
SECRETARYTracey joined the Business Port Augusta Board in 2023. As a solutions-focused professional and practicing sole trader, she bridges economic development strategy with the practical needs of small businesses.
Professional Journey
Tracey began her career in Port Augusta’s tourism sector before spending 20 years in Adelaide across government and technology roles. She returned home in 2020 and now runs Savvy Pixels (IT solutions) and leads Career Choice Resumes, continuing her mother Eifron’s legacy in professional career development.

Shane Packard
DEPUTY CHAIRPERSONDeputy Chair since 2024, Shane Packard has played a key role in supporting Port Augusta’s business community through tough times like COVID-19. He focuses on practical strategies to both support existing businesses and actively attract new investment to the town – recognising that economic growth creates opportunities for all enterprises—including his own.
Professional Journey
Shane started out in the trades before moving into radio advertising with 5AU, where he built strong skills in branding and sales. In 2001, he co-founded Crossroads Concepts, an award-winning signwriting business that reflects his hands-on approach and strong local connections.

Ruby Duka
BOARD MEMBERRuby joined the Business Port Augusta Board in 2024, bringing a strong commitment to supporting and advocating for local businesses. As a passionate business owner, she is dedicated to helping the Port Augusta business community not only survive but thrive.
Professional Journey
Ruby is the Owner and Director of Tickle Belly Hill, a popular café and function centre just outside Port Augusta. Since acquiring the business in late 2022, she has grown it to employ over eight local staff and host a variety of community events. With a background in tourism and hospitality, Ruby brings valuable experience in sales, management, and customer service.
Craig Shirley
BOARD MEMBERCraig joined the Business Port Augusta Board in 2025, bringing experience in youth services and workforce development. As Far North Community Engagement Coordinator at Uni Hub Spencer Gulf, he works to connect regional communities with education and employment pathways that keep skilled people in Port Augusta.
Professional Journey
Craig has built his career in youth work and employment services, understanding firsthand the barriers regional communities face in accessing education and meaningful work. His current role focuses on expanding higher education opportunities across the Far North, helping residents build careers without leaving home.
